Josef Friedrich submitted the
luatex-type-definitions
package.
Version: 0.1.0 2025-07-13
License: gpl2+
Summary description: Type definitions for the Lua API of LuaTeX
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
LuaTeX has a very large Lua API. This project tries to make this
API accessible in the text editor of your choice.
This is made possible by the lua-language-server — a server that
implements the Language Server Protocol (LSP) for the Lua language.
Features such as code completion, syntax highlighting and marking
of warnings and errors, should therefore not only be possible
in Visual Studio Code, but in a large number of editors that
support the LSP.

Karl Berry submitted an update to the
gentium-sil
package.
Version: 7.000 2025-07-13
License: ofl
Summary description: A complete Greek font with Latin and Cyrillic, too
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
This update to the gentium-sil package now includes the Gentium Book
sibling family, originally omitted merely by oversight.
The Gentium Book design is a slightly heavier weight version of Gentium.
The Gentium and GentiumBook subdirectories are exactly as released by
SIL (https://software.sil.org/gentium), with no changes whatsoever.

Jasper Nice submitted the
lua-tikz3dtools
package.
Version: 1.0.0 2025-07-13
License: lppl1.3c
Summary description: A LuaLaTeX package which improves on 3D capabilities in TikZ
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
The `lua-tikz3dtools` package is an early experimental extension to
TikZ that aims to improve 3D rendering by handling geometry in Lua.
It currently supports z-sorting and occlusion for triangulated parametric
surfaces, line segments, and points. Parametric objects are defined using
`pgfkeys`, and users can apply linear, affine, and projective transformations.
All 3D math is handled on the Lua side, and the results are projected onto
the 2D TikZ canvas.
The package is still under development. Its current focus is to add
support for clipping parametric geometry and to refine the occlusion logic
for more complicated scenes.
